ISLAMABAD—Graduating from college is an exhilarating milestone, especially for those eager to dive into the dynamic world of media. With numerous career paths available, the media industry offers exciting opportunities for fresh graduates to apply their skills, creativity, and passion. Here's a guide to some of the best media jobs for recent graduates.
1. Journalist
If you have a knack for storytelling and a passion for current events, a career in journalism might be perfect for you. Whether you aspire to be a reporter, news anchor, or investigative journalist, this field allows you to explore diverse topics and share important stories with the public.
2. Public Relations Specialist
Public relations specialists play a crucial role in shaping and maintaining the public image of organizations. As a PR specialist, you'll craft press releases, manage media relations, and develop communication strategies to enhance the reputation of your clients or company.
3. Digital Marketing Coordinator
With the rise of digital media, the demand for digital marketing professionals has surged. As a digital marketing coordinator, you'll manage online campaigns, analyze performance metrics, and create engaging content to promote brands and products across various digital platforms.
4. Social Media Manager
Social media managers are responsible for developing and executing social media strategies to engage audiences and build brand loyalty. This role involves creating content, managing social media accounts, and analyzing engagement metrics to optimize performance.
5. Content Writer/Copywriter
If you have a flair for writing, a career as a content writer or copywriter can be both fulfilling and lucrative. These roles involve creating compelling content for websites, blogs, advertisements, and social media, helping to drive traffic and convert readers into customers.
6. Broadcast Production Assistant
For those interested in television or radio, a position as a broadcast production assistant offers hands-on experience in the industry. You'll assist with the production of live shows, manage technical equipment, and coordinate with various departments to ensure smooth broadcasts.
7. Graphic Designer
Graphic designers create visual content to communicate messages effectively. In the media industry, graphic designers work on everything from branding and advertising to web design and multimedia projects, using their artistic skills to captivate audiences.
8. Videographer/Video Editor
Videographers and video editors play a vital role in producing engaging video content. From shooting footage to editing and post-production, these professionals bring stories to life through visual storytelling and technical expertise.
9. Podcast Producer
The popularity of podcasts has opened up new opportunities for media graduates. As a podcast producer, you'll be involved in planning, recording, editing, and promoting podcast episodes, working closely with hosts and guests to create compelling audio content.
10. Media Analyst
Media analysts track and evaluate media coverage to provide insights and recommendations. This role involves monitoring news outlets, analyzing trends, and compiling reports to help organizations understand their media presence and make informed decisions.
Entering the media industry can be challenging, but with determination and the right opportunities, recent graduates can build rewarding and impactful careers. Whether you're passionate about writing, digital marketing, or visual storytelling, there's a media job out there that's perfect for you.
